Docs
Connect
Connect
Overview
TypeScript
React
React Native
.NET
Unity
Unreal
Engine
Contracts
Tools
Tools
Chain List
Wei Converter
Hex Converter
Account
API Keys
CLI
Search Docs
K
Support
Support
Support Site
Contact Sales
Changelog
TypeScript SDK
Types
Extensions
DEPLOY
PrepareDirectDeployTransactionOptions
DeployERC1155ContractOptions
DeployERC20ContractOptions
DeployERC721ContractOptions
DeployPublishedContractOptions
DeploySplitContractOptions
ERC1155ContractParams
ERC1155ContractType
ERC20ContractParams
ERC721ContractParams
ERC721ContractType
PREBUILT
SplitContractParams
AIRDROP
ClaimERC1155Params
ClaimERC20Params
ClaimERC721Params
GenerateAirdropERC1155SignatureOptions
GenerateAirdropERC20SignatureOptions
GenerateAirdropERC721SignatureOptions
GenerateMerkleTreeInfoERC1155Params
GenerateMerkleTreeInfoERC20Params
GenerateMerkleTreeInfoERC721Params
SaveSnapshotParams
COMMON
SetContractMetadataParams
ENS
ResolveAddressOptions
ResolveAvatarOptions
ResolveNameOptions
ResolveTextOptions
ERC1155
ClaimToParams
GenerateMintSignatureOptions
GetNFTParams
GetNFTsParams
GetOwnedNFTsParams
LazyMintParams
MintAdditionalSupplyToParams
MintToParams
SetClaimConditionsParams
UpdateMetadataParams
UpdateTokenURIParams
ERC1271
CheckContractWalletSignatureOptions
ERC20
ApproveParams
ClaimToParams
DepositParams
GenerateMintSignatureOptions
GetBalanceParams
GetBalanceResult
GetCurrencyMetadataResult
MintToParams
SetClaimConditionsParams
TransferBatchParams
TransferFromParams
TransferParams
ERC4337
AddAdminOptions
AddSessionKeyOptions
RemoveAdminOptions
RemoveSessionKeyOptions
ERC721
BatchToReveal
ClaimToParams
CreateDelayedRevealBatchParams
GetAllOwnersParams
GetNFTParams
GetNFTsParams
GetOwnedNFTsParams
GetOwnedTokenIdsParams
LazyMintParams
MintToParams
RevealParams
SetClaimConditionsParams
SetSharedMetadataParams
UpdateMetadataParams
UpdateTokenURIParams
FARCASTER
AddMessage
AddSignerForParams
AddSignerParams
Ed25519Keypair
FarcasterContractOptions
GetFidParams
GetNonceParams
GetRegistrationPriceParams
GetStoragePriceParams
GetUsdRegistrationPriceParams
GetUsdStoragePriceParams
RegisterFidAndSignerParams
RegisterFidParams
RegisterMessage
RentStorageParams
SignedKeyRequestMessage
LENS
FullProfileResponse
GetFullProfileParams
GetHandleFromProfileIdParams
GetProfileMetadataParams
LensProfileSchema
MARKETPLACE
AcceptOfferParams
BidInAuctionParams
BuyFromListingParams
BuyoutAuctionParams
CreateAuctionParams
CreateListingParams
CurrencyPriceForListingParams
DirectListing
EnglishAuction
ExecuteSaleParams
GetAllAuctionParams
GetAllListingParams
GetAllOffersParams
GetAllValidAuctionParams
GetAllValidListingParams
GetAllValidOffersParams
GetAuctionParams
GetListingParams
GetOfferParams
GetWinningBidParams
IsBuyerApprovedForListingParams
MakeOfferParams
Offer
UpdateListingParams
MODULAR
InstallPublishedExtensionOptions
UninstallExtensionByProxyOptions
UninstallPublishedExtensionOptions
PERMISSIONS
GetAllRoleMembersParams
GetRoleAdminParams
GetRoleMemberCountParams
GetRoleMemberParams
GrantRoleParams
HasRoleParams
RenounceRoleParams
RevokeRoleParams
SPLIT
SplitRecipient
UNISWAP
GetUniswapV3PoolParams
GetUniswapV3PoolResult
Chain
Chain
ChainMetadata
ChainOptions
Contract
ContractOptions
ThirdwebContract
Buy Crypto
BuyHistoryData
BuyHistoryParams
BuyWithCryptoHistoryData
BuyWithCryptoHistoryParams
BuyWithCryptoQuote
BuyWithCryptoStatus
BuyWithCryptoTransaction
BuyWithFiatHistoryData
BuyWithFiatHistoryParams
BuyWithFiatQuote
BuyWithFiatStatus
GetBuyWithCryptoQuoteParams
GetBuyWithFiatQuoteParams
GetBuyWithFiatStatusParams
GetPostOnRampQuoteParams
QuoteApprovalParams
QuoteTokenInfo
Auth
AuthOptions
Erc6492Signature
GenerateLoginPayloadParams
LoginPayload
ParseErc6492SignatureReturnType
SignLoginPayloadParams
VerifyContractWalletSignatureParams
VerifyEOASignatureParams
VerifyLoginPayloadParams
VerifyLoginPayloadResult
SiweAuthOptions
Connect Wallet
ConnectButtonProps
ConnectButton_connectButtonOptions
ConnectButton_connectModalOptions
ConnectButton_detailsButtonOptions
ConnectButton_detailsModalOptions
NetworkSelectorProps
UseConnectModalOptions
UseNetworkSwitcherModalOptions
WelcomeScreen
Theme
Theme
ThemeOverrides
Others
VerifySignatureParams
ERC20ContractType
GetContractEventsOptions
GetContractEventsResult
ParseEventLogsOptions
ParseEventLogsResult
PrepareEventOptions
PreparedEvent
WatchContractEventsOptions
AirdropERC1155Params
AirdropERC20Params
AirdropERC721Params
AirdropNativeTokenParams
IsClaimedParams
SetMerkleRootParams
TokenConditionIdParams
TokenMerkleRootParams
GetRoyaltyInfoForTokenParams
MulticallParams
OwnerUpdatedEventFilters
SetContractURIParams
SetDefaultRoyaltyInfoParams
SetOwnerParams
SetPlatformFeeInfoParams
SetPrimarySaleRecipientParams
SetRoyaltyInfoForTokenParams
ApprovalForAllEventFilters
BalanceOfBatchParams
BalanceOfParams
BurnBatchParams
BurnParams
CreatePackParams
GetClaimConditionByIdParams
IsApprovedForAllParams
OpenPackParams
PackCreatedEventFilters
PackOpenedEventFilters
PackUpdatedEventFilters
SafeBatchTransferFromParams
SafeTransferFromParams
SetApprovalForAllParams
SetTokenURIParams
TokensMintedWithSignatureEventFilters
TotalSupplyParams
TransferBatchEventFilters
TransferSingleEventFilters
UriParams
AllowanceParams
ApprovalEventFilters
BalanceOfParams
BurnFromParams
BurnParams
GetApprovalForTransactionParams
TokensClaimedEventFilters
TokensMintedEventFilters
TokensMintedWithSignatureEventFilters
TransferEventFilters
WithdrawParams
GetAccountsOfSignerParams
GetPermissionsForSignerParams
GetUserOpHashParams
IsActiveSignerParams
PredictAccountAddressParams
SimulateHandleOpParams
ConvertToAssetsParams
ConvertToSharesParams
DepositEventFilters
DepositParams
MaxDepositParams
MaxMintParams
MaxRedeemParams
MaxWithdrawParams
MintParams
PreviewDepositParams
PreviewMintParams
PreviewRedeemParams
PreviewWithdrawParams
RedeemParams
WithdrawEventFilters
WithdrawParams
ApprovalEventFilters
ApprovalForAllEventFilters
ApproveParams
BalanceOfParams
BurnParams
GenerateMintSignatureOptions
IsApprovedForAllParams
OwnerOfParams
SetApprovalForAllParams
SetTokenURIParams
TokenOfOwnerByIndexParams
TokenURIParams
TokenURIRevealedEventFilters
TokensClaimedEventFilters
TokensLazyMintedEventFilters
TokensMintedWithSignatureEventFilters
TokensOfOwnerParams
TransferEventFilters
TransferFromParams
PriceParams
RegisterParams
PriceParams
RegisterForParams
RegisterParams
ChangeRecoveryAddressParams
CustodyOfParams
IdOfParams
RecoverForParams
RecoverParams
RecoveryOfParams
TransferAndChangeRecoveryParams
TransferForParams
TransferParams
VerifyFidSignatureParams
PriceParams
ExistsParams
GetContentURIParams
GetDefaultHandleParams
GetFollowDataParams
GetFollowTokenIdParams
GetFollowerProfileIdParams
GetHandleParams
GetLocalNameParams
GetModuleTypesParams
GetOriginalFollowTimestampParams
GetProfileIdAllowedToRecoverParams
GetProfileIdByHandleHashParams
GetProfileParams
GetPublicationParams
GetTokenIdParams
IsErc20CurrencyRegisteredParams
IsFollowingParams
IsModuleRegisteredAsParams
IsModuleRegisteredParams
MintTimestampOfFollowNFTParams
MintTimestampOfParams
NoncesParams
ResolveParams
TokenDataOfParams
AcceptedOfferEventFilters
ApproveBuyerForListingParams
ApproveCurrencyForListingParams
AuctionClosedEventFilters
BuyerApprovedForListingEventFilters
CancelAuctionParams
CancelListingParams
CancelOfferParams
CancelledAuctionEventFilters
CancelledListingEventFilters
CancelledOfferEventFilters
CollectAuctionPayoutParams
CollectAuctionTokensParams
CurrencyApprovedForListingEventFilters
IsCurrencyApprovedForListingParams
IsNewWinningBidParams
NewAuctionEventFilters
NewBidEventFilters
NewListingEventFilters
NewOfferEventFilters
NewSaleEventFilters
UpdatedListingEventFilters
CompleteOwnershipHandoverParams
GrantRolesParams
HasAllRolesParams
HasAnyRoleParams
InstallExtensionParams
OwnershipHandoverExpiresAtParams
RenounceRolesParams
RevokeRolesParams
RolesOfParams
TransferOwnershipParams
UninstallExtensionParams
Aggregate3Params
Aggregate3ValueParams
AggregateParams
BlockAndAggregateParams
GetBlockHashParams
GetEthBalanceParams
TryAggregateParams
TryBlockAndAggregateParams
RoleAdminChangedEventFilters
RoleGrantedEventFilters
RoleRevokedEventFilters
PayeeParams
ReleasableByTokenParams
ReleasableParams
ReleaseByTokenParams
ReleaseParams
ReleasedParams
SharesParams
CreatePoolParams
EnableFeeAmountParams
ExactInputParams
ExactInputSingleParams
ExactOutputParams
ExactOutputSingleParams
FeeAmountTickSpacingParams
GetPoolParams
QuoteExactInputParams
QuoteExactInputSingleParams
QuoteExactOutputParams
QuoteExactOutputSingleParams
SetOwnerParams
CastVoteBySigParams
CastVoteParams
CastVoteWithReasonAndParamsBySigParams
CastVoteWithReasonAndParamsParams
CastVoteWithReasonParams
ExecuteParams
GetVotesParams
GetVotesWithParamsParams
HasVotedParams
HashProposalParams
ProposalDeadlineParams
ProposalSnapshotParams
ProposalVotesParams
ProposalsParams
ProposeParams
QuorumParams
RelayParams
SetProposalThresholdParams
SetVotingDelayParams
SetVotingPeriodParams
StateParams
UpdateQuorumNumeratorParams
PayOnChainTransactionDetails
PayTokenInfo
AutoConnectProps
BuyDirectListingButtonProps
ClaimButtonProps
ConnectEmbedProps
ConnectManagerOptions
CreateDirectListingButtonProps
DirectPaymentOptions
FundWalletOptions
LocaleId
MediaRendererProps
PayEmbedConnectOptions
PayEmbedProps
PayUIOptions
PaymentInfo
SendTransactionConfig
SendTransactionPayModalConfig
SupportedTokens
TokenInfo
TranasctionOptions
TransactionButtonProps
UseBlockNumberOptions
UseWalletDetailsModalOptions
WatchBlockNumberOptions
DownloadOptions
ResolveArweaveSchemeOptions
ResolveSchemeOptions
UnpinOptions
UploadMobileOptions
UploadOptions
AbiParameterToPrimitiveType
Address
AddressInput
BaseTransactionOptions
BoolToBytesOpts
BoolToHexOpts
BytesToBigIntOpts
BytesToBoolOpts
BytesToNumberOpts
BytesToStringOpts
CreateThirdwebClientOptions
EstimateGasOptions
FromBytesParameters
FromBytesReturnType
FromHexParameters
FromHexReturnType
GetGasPriceOptions
Hex
HexToBigIntOpts
HexToBoolOpts
HexToBytesOpts
HexToNumberOpts
HexToStringOpts
HexToUint8ArrayOpts
IsHexOptions
NFT
NumberToHexOpts
PrepareContractCallOptions
PrepareTransactionOptions
PreparedTransaction
ReadContractOptions
SendBatchTransactionOptions
SendTransactionOptions
SimulateOptions
StringToBytesOpts
StringToHexOpts
ThirdwebClient
ToBytesParameters
ToHexParameters
ToSerializableTransactionOptions
Uint8ArrayToHexOpts
VerifyTypedDataParams
EstimateGasCostResult
EstimateGasResult
ReadContractResult
SerializeTransactionOptions
SignTransactionOptions
StoredTransaction
TransactionReceipt
WaitForReceiptOptions
ExtendedMetadata
GetClaimParamsOptions
JWTPayload
JWTPayloadInput
NFTInput
NFTMetadata
RefreshJWTParams
SignMessageOptions
SignOptions
SignTypedDataOptions
Account
AdapterWalletOptions
CoinbaseSDKWalletConnectionOptions
CoinbaseWalletCreationOptions
ConnectionManager
ConnectionStatus
CreateWalletArgs
DeepLinkSupportedWalletCreationOptions
EcosystemWalletAutoConnectOptions
EcosystemWalletConnectionOptions
EcosystemWalletCreationOptions
GenerateAccountOptions
GetWalletBalanceOptions
InAppWalletAuth
InAppWalletAutoConnectOptions
InAppWalletConnectionOptions
InAppWalletSocialAuth
InjectedConnectOptions
InjectedSupportedWalletIds
PrivateKeyToAccountOptions
SmartWalletConnectionOptions
SmartWalletOptions
StandaloneWCConnectOptions
WCAutoConnectOptions
WCConnectOptions
WCSupportedWalletIds
Wallet
WalletAutoConnectionOption
WalletConnectClient
WalletConnectSession
WalletConnectionOption
WalletCreationOptions
WalletEmitter
WalletEmitterEvents
WalletId
WalletInfo
GetCallsStatusOptions
GetCallsStatusResponse
GetCapabilitiesOptions
GetCapabilitiesResult
PrepareCallOptions
PreparedSendCall
SendCallsOptions
SendCallsResult
WaitForBundleOptions
WalletCallReceipt
WalletCapabilities
WalletCapabilitiesRecord
WalletSendCallsId
WalletSendCallsParameters
GetAuthenticatedUserParams
InAppWalletCreationOptions
PaymasterResult
UserOperation
On this page